It’s National Gay Men’s HIV/AIDS Awareness Day. Now Go Get Tested

Today is National Gay Men’s HIV/AIDS Awareness Day. It’s not politically correct to say, but there’s no denying that men who have sex with men are a disturbingly large segment of the HIV-positive population. One of the biggest problems is gay and bisexual men who don’t know they’re positive.

So be a part of the solution: Get yourself tested today.

And we’re not gonna let you off the hook because you can’t get an appointment with your doctor. A great widget, the HIV/AIDS Prevention and Service Locator, links users with facilities offering testing, treatment, mental-health and substance-abuse services and other resources.

Just enter your zip code or nearest town for locations, which are presented on an interactive map. Click on markers on the map for more details and directions for each location.

Until there’s a cure, knowledge is our strongest medicine.
